Find the equation for the line shown on the right.

What is the equation for the line shown on the right?

Answer:


x = 8

Explanation:

Given

See attachment for graph

Required

The line graph

First, consider the following points on the graph.


(x_1,y_1) = (8,0)


(x_2,y_2) = (8,8)

First, calculate the slope.


m = (y_2 - y_1)/(x_2 - x_1)


m = (8-0)/(8-8)


m = (8)/(0)


m = undefined

Since, the slope is undefined; we simply consider only the value of x.

The line equation is:


x = 8
